Football/ CHAN 2025: Senegal begins title defense against Nigeria

Senegal kicks off its 2025 African Nations Championship (CHAN) campaign with a highly anticipated clash against Nigeria. This opening group-stage match brings together two African football powerhouses on Tuesday at the Benjamin Mkapa National Stadium in Dar es Salaam, Tanzania. Kick-off is set for 8 PM local time (GMT+3), which corresponds to 5 PM in Dakar and Lagos, and 7 PM in France.

Crowned champions in 2023, Senegal’s local-based Lions are determined to defend their title. Their opponents, Nigeria’s Super Eagles A’, were runners-up in the 2018 edition and are eager to make a strong statement this time around.

The match promises to deliver high-level football, with both sides featuring talented players from their domestic leagues. Fans can follow the action live on RTS (Senegal), NTA (Nigeria), and beIN Sports 1 (France), ensuring wide coverage of this thrilling encounter.

Beyond the prestige, this game is crucial in shaping the path to qualification. With so much at stake, both teams will be looking to make a strong start and assert dominance in CHAN 2025. Expect intensity, skill, and national pride as the tournament gets underway.
